In the semi-finals of the UEFA Nations League, Spain won a thrilling game against France 5:4 (2:0) and thus secured a place in the final against Portugal. The game took place on June 5, 2025 in Stuttgart, where the Spaniards performed in front of an impressive backdrop. Coach Luis Enrique's team surprised many with a strong first half, in which Nico Williams (22nd minute) and Mikel Merino (25th minute) gave them an early 2-0 lead. Dean Huijsen, who was making his international debut, then scored in the 43rd minute, but his goal was disallowed due to an offside decision. 

Lamine Yamal, just 17 years old, eventually became player of the game. Not only did he score a penalty in the 54th minute after Adrien Rabiot fouled him in the penalty area, but he made it 5-1 in the 67th minute, capitalizing on an assist from Pedro Porro. Spain had impressive control of the game up to this point, even leading 4-0 at one point, before the French team showed a strong reaction.

France's attempts to turn the game around

Didier Deschamps' team managed to make the game exciting again. Kylian Mbappé converted a penalty to make it 1-4 in the 59th minute after Pedro Porro fouled Mbappé. Rayan Cherki and Randal Kolo Muani contributed to the final score of 5-4 in the final minutes after Daniel Vivian scored an own goal. Unai Simón, the Spanish goalkeeper, played a crucial role in the first half, thwarting several great chances, including from Mbappé.

Overall, the game was an exciting back and forth that captivated the spectators. Spain has remained unbeaten in 19 international matches and without defeat in 24 competitive matches. The team suffered its last competitive defeat in March 2023 and is in the UEFA Nations League final for the third time in a row.

A look at the UEFA Nations League

The UEFA Nations League, which has consisted of 55 UEFA member associations since it was first held in the 2018/19 season, was created to reduce the importance of friendlies and promote competitiveness between national teams. The competition takes place every two years and includes various phases such as the group stage, the Final Four and play-offs. The Reyes league systems A, B, C and D are based on the UEFA coefficients, with the four group winners of League A playing in the final round for the title. Spain could win their first title in Nations League history with a win in the final against Portugal. The importance of this league is also highlighted by its role in qualifying for the UEFA European Championship and the FIFA World Cup.
